**Ticket: Pricing experiment skew in FareLoom**

Variant B of the ticket-pricing experiment is applying the weekend multiplier on weekdays, inflating quotes ~12%. Exposure is limited to the Northbay test cohort. Fix is merged and awaiting your sign-off for the patch train. Confirmed fixed in the build below.

pipeline stamp: htk3_69f

Handover note — Reception, Bramwick House

Marta, before I head off: the evacuation-chair store on Level 2 (beside the stairwell by Meeting Room Fern) was restocked Tuesday. Two chairs, both serviced by Caldon Safety. Monthly checks are logged in the red folder at the desk. Keep the door locked at all times; cleaners sometimes leave it ajar. The door-pass code for the store is below.

turnstile pass: bdg-QZV-3

## Profile Shard Router API

The Marrowgate profile store is sharded 32 ways by user-ID hash. Clients never pick shards; route all reads and writes through the shard router at the internal endpoint. Cross-shard queries go through the aggregator, capped at 500 ms. Requests must authenticate with the router key shown below.

API key for fadug-fafof: kto7_7rjklQM

Subject: Deed pickup tomorrow

Hi dispatch — quick one for the records team. The notarised deed for the Copperline Wharf sale is ready in the mail room, sealed in the red envelope. Fenwick Couriers will collect it around noon. Please log it out before release. Give the rider this instruction at hand-over.

dispatch memo: the lamwyn fenwyn courier leaves the wenir ledger at gate 7175 under passcode 822969

**Runbook: Account Recovery — Wavelet Gateway**

Heads up, plugin folks: if your plugin keeps the socket open during recovery, turn permessage-deflate OFF. Compression saves bandwidth on chatty streams, but recovery payloads are small and the CPU hit on Wavelet's edge nodes isn't worth it. Worse, compressed frames can stall behind the reset handshake and you'll see phantom timeouts. Plain frames, short pings, done. If recovery still hangs, reconnect uncompressed and retry once. Use the passphrase below to re-arm the flow.

vault phrase of kawep-tahog = ulaix-briath